Judges 15:16-18
New American Standard Bible
16 And Samson said,
“With the jawbone of a donkey,
[a]Heaps upon heaps,
With the jawbone of a donkey
I have [b]killed a thousand men.”
17 When he had finished speaking, he threw the jawbone from his hand; and he named that place [c]Ramath-lehi. 18 Then he became very thirsty, and he (A)called to the Lord and said, “You have [d]handed this great [e]victory over to Your servant, and now [f]am I to die of thirst [g]and fall into the hands of the uncircumcised?”
